Stephen Fry believes that if you can speak & read English you can write poetry. But it is no fun if you don`t know where to start or have been led to believe that Anything Goes. Stephen, who has long written poems, & indeed has written long poems, for his own private pleasure, invites you to discover the incomparable delights of metre, rhyme & verse forms. Whether you want to write a Petrarchan sonnet for your lover`s birthday, an epithalamion for your sister`s wedding or a villanelle excoriating the government`s housing policy, The Ode Less Travelled will give you the tools & the confidence to do so. Brimful of enjoyable exercises, witty insights & simple step-by-step advice, ” The Ode Less Travelled” guides the reader towards mastery & confidence in the Mother of the Arts.
